Get Instant Help From 5000+ Experts For
question

Writing: Get your essay and assignment written from scratch by PhD expert

Rewriting: Paraphrase or rewrite your friend's essay with similar meaning at reduced cost

Editing:Proofread your work by experts and improve grade at Lowest cost

And Improve Your Grades
myassignmenthelp.com
loader
Phone no. Missing!

Enter phone no. to receive critical updates and urgent messages !

Attach file

Error goes here

Files Missing!

Please upload all relevant files for quick & complete assistance.

Guaranteed Higher Grade!
Free Quote
wave

Briefly describe how would you obtain the information needed for the development of a use case model to analyse the requirements of the proposed system. Draw a Use Case Diagram and document use case descriptions to represent the required functionality of the system.

Establish a scholarly supported argument, discussing the benefits of offering a mobile application in addition to the website. You may start by exploring perceptions of, and behaviours related to, the use of mobile apps in similar businesses. You must use at least five references to support your argument.

Develop a Work Breakdown Structure (WBS) – organized by product and in at least three levels of details – for the front-end of a mobile application, which helps the management to understand the scope and complexity of the development project. You are required to demonstrate how the suggested WBS can be used by the management.

UC-1: REGISTRATION for individual client

Use Case ID

Primary Actor

Use Cases

UC-1

Clients

Booking details: occupation, add password, add Email Address, address.

 Payment for membership

 log in

Database

Registration: occupation, add password, add Email Address, address.

Verify credentials

system

Conformation email: Register details

Validate credentials

UC-2

Clients

Booking details: occupation, add Email Address, address.

 Payment for membership

 log in

Database

Registration: occupation, add password, add Email Address, address.

Verify credentials

system

Conformation email: Register details

Validate credentials

UC-3

client

provide booking details: number of attendees, desired location, food menu, music genres, price limit, date and time

select venue

Finalize the booking

Database

Available venues

Tax invoice

System

Available venues

Confirmation email: tax invoice

Use Case ID:

UC-1

Use Case Name:

REGISTRATION for individual client

Created By:

Date Created:

Actors:

In this use case. Three actors are located as system, database and client.  

Description:

It shows the registration process for individual as they need to provide personal information in order to register into the system. Client need to share the email address, address and add password. Later these information are stored into the system and the systems sends a confirmation email which consists the registration details. Clients can login through this credentials in order to search for information.

Trigger:

If any individual client want to book a venue for private functions, they must open the web or mobile application of the Findyourvenue in order to trigger the functions.

Preconditions:

 

1. Attendees limit for private functions is limited to Maximum 500.

Postconditions:

1. Free registration for unlimited time.

Normal Flow:

When user will login with their credentials :: system will validate the inputs with the information stored in the database.

.

Alternative Flows:

[Alternative Flow 1 – Not in Network]

Forgot username or password

System can resend the registration details to the registered email.  

Exceptions:

If users search results does not return any result, system can provide the next vacancy date available for the desired venue.

Includes:

1. Registration

2.Conformation email

3.Login includes

Includes

1.Email address and password.

2.Registration details.

3.Validate credentials.

Frequency of Use:

new user want to register

Special Requirements:

Clients’ needs to be individual customer.

The desired venue location must be under the operating area of the organization.

Assumptions:

This uses cases are created while strictly following the case study and no assumptions are used to doing so.  

Notes and Issues:

The use case are constructed while following the basic instruction. In order to evaluate system like “Findyourvenue” in real life, much complex use case functions required.

Use Case ID:

UC-2

Use Case Name:

REGISTRATION for business executives

Created By:

Date Created:

Actors:

In this use case. Three actors are located as system, database and client.  

Description:

It shows the registration process for individual as they need to provide personal information in order to register into the system. Client need to share the email address, address and add password. The system auto generate an username and later these information are stored into the system and the systems sends a confirmation email which consists the registration details. Clients can login through this credentials in order to search for information.

Trigger:

If any business executive want to book a venue, they must open the web or mobile application of the findyotvenye in order to trigger the functions.

Preconditions:

1. Minimum 100 attends per book is essential for business customers.

 

 

Postconditions:

2. User will be able to use the application for one year after paying $100.

Normal Flow:

When the user will request for registration :: system will provide a username.

When user will login with their credentials :: system will validate the inputs with the information stored in the database.

Alternative Flows:

[Alternative Flow 1 – Not in Network]

Forgot username or password

System can resend the registration details to the registered email.  

Exceptions:

If users search results does not return any result, system can provide the next vacancy date available for the desired venue.

Includes:

3. Registration

2.Conformation email

3.Login includes

Includes

1.Email address and password.

2.Registration details.

3.Validate credentials.

Frequency of Use:

new user want to register

Special Requirements:

Clients’ needs to be either business executives.

Assumptions:

This uses cases are created while strictly following the case study and no assumptions are used to doing so.  

Notes and Issues:

The use case are constructed while following the basic instruction. In order to evaluate system like “Findyourvenue” in real life, much complex use case functions required.

Use Case ID:

UC-3

Use Case Name:

Booking system

Created By:

Date Created:

Actors:

In this use case. Three actors are located as system, database and client.

Description:

This use case diagram provides the functionality which must be conducted by identified actors. In order to book any venue, clients’ needs to register into the system.

Trigger:

Client must have an authenticated membership.

Preconditions:

 

2. Attendees limit for private functions is limited to Maximum 500.

3. Minimum 100 attends per book is essential for business customers.

 

Postconditions:

Minimal guarantee:

1. Clients will be able to check the available venues without finalizing any venue.

Success guarantee:

1. User will be able to use the application for one year after paying $100.

2. Use can book a venue after paying the full amount.

Normal Flow:

Deliver booking details such as number of attendees, desired location, food menu, music genres, date and time, and price range :: system will showcase available venues.

Finalize the venue and make payment :: send confirmation email along with tax invoices.

Alternative Flows:

[Alternative Flow 1 – Not in Network]

Unavailability of desired venue.

System can suggest some venues which are someway related to the desired venue.

unable to pay required payment

System can offer alternative payment methods.

Exceptions:

If users search results does not return any result, system can provide the next vacancy date available for the desired venue.

Includes:

Finalize venue

Confirmation email

includes

Full payment.

Tax invoice.

Frequency of Use:

On demand as many time as required.

Special Requirements:

Clients’ needs to be either business executives or individual customer.

The desired venue location must be under the operating area of the organization.

Assumptions:

This uses cases are created while strictly following the case study and no assumptions are used to doing so.  

Notes and Issues:

The use case are constructed while following the basic instruction. In order to evaluate system like “Findyourvenue” in real life, much complex use case functions required.

There are several advantages to develop a mobile application along with the web application as it can offer more functionality which would beneficial for any certain organization. Mobile applications are more suitable to engage with potential customer frequently and notify the users about different information. Business can also gather location related data and understand the popularity of their services or products by analysing network. Addition to that, NFC technology is embedded in mobile devices which enables secure transaction among the client and business. Other than that, mobile application offers more accessibility and functionality over the simple web application.

  • Mobile Apps are faster
  • Personalized content
  • Instant Online and Offline access
  • Using device features
  • Push Notifications and instant updates
  • Branding and Design
  • Productivity Improvement and Cost reduction
  • Interactive Engagement
  • Increased SEO potential for your website

Work breakdown structure is designed to set a baseline which must be followed throughout the project lifecycle. Every activity is categorise in several phases depends on their dependencies. For instance, walls cannot be painted before primer has been done. From the above figure, it is identified that the project planning is the trigger and the development process ends after handing over the project to client tasks (Charland and Leroux 2013). The initiation phase is associated with defining scope, resources, stakeholders and other fundamental planning. Next the software and platforms are selected along the resource allocation. After that, the project design is conducted where the application is developed while considering the project scope. After developing the application, it is run through several testing to validate the application. Then the system will be handed to the client.

Conclusion: 

This report consist of three topics associated with Scencebroker. The first topic showcase the use cases of the Findyoursvenue. The second topic consists description of advantages of mobile application over the web application. The third topic presents a work breakdown structure and explanation.

Bakshi, K., 2013, March. Considerations for software defined networking (SDN): Approaches and use cases. In Aerospace Conference, 2013 IEEE (pp. 1-9). IEEE.

Ku, I., Lu, Y. and Gerla, M., 2014, August. Software-defined mobile cloud: Architecture, services and use cases. In Wireless Communications and Mobile Computing Conference (IWCMC), 2014 International (pp. 1-6). IEEE.

Holmberg, C., Hakansson, S. and Eriksson, G., 2015. Web real-time communication use cases and requirements (No. RFC 7478).

Coleman, C.A., Seaton, D.T. and Chuang, I., 2015, March. Probabilistic use cases: Discovering behavioral patterns for predicting certification. In Proceedings of the Second (2015) ACM Conference on Learning@ Scale (pp. 141-148). ACM.

Rumbaugh, J., Jacobson, I. and Booch, G., 2004. Unified modeling language reference manual, the. Pearson Higher Education.

Coad, P., Yourdon, E. and Coad, P., 1991. Object-oriented analysis (Vol. 2). Englewood Cliffs, NJ: Yourdon press.

Motiwalla, L.F., 2007. Mobile learning: A framework and evaluation. Computers & education, 49(3), pp.581-596.

Jeng, Y.L., Wu, T.T., Huang, Y.M., Tan, Q. and Yang, S.J., 2015. The add-on impact of mobile applications in learning strategies: A review study. Educational Technology & Society, 13(3), pp.3-11.

Charland, A. and Leroux, B., 2013. Mobile application development: web vs. native. Queue, 9(4), p.20.

Lu, Y., Yang, S., Chau, P.Y. and Cao, Y., 2011. Dynamics between the trust transfer process and intention to use mobile payment services: A cross-environment perspective. Information & Management, 48(8), pp.393-403.

Shankar, V. and Balasubramanian, S., 2013. Mobile marketing: a synthesis and prognosis. Journal of interactive marketing, 23(2), pp.118-129.

Marchewka, J.T., 2014. Information technology project management. John Wiley & Sons.

Cite This Work

To export a reference to this article please select a referencing stye below:

My Assignment Help. (2020). Use Cases For Findyourvenue Booking System. Retrieved from https://myassignmenthelp.com/free-samples/ict115-introduction-to-systems-design-11.

"Use Cases For Findyourvenue Booking System." My Assignment Help, 2020, https://myassignmenthelp.com/free-samples/ict115-introduction-to-systems-design-11.

My Assignment Help (2020) Use Cases For Findyourvenue Booking System [Online]. Available from: https://myassignmenthelp.com/free-samples/ict115-introduction-to-systems-design-11
[Accessed 23 February 2024].

My Assignment Help. 'Use Cases For Findyourvenue Booking System' (My Assignment Help, 2020) <https://myassignmenthelp.com/free-samples/ict115-introduction-to-systems-design-11> accessed 23 February 2024.

My Assignment Help. Use Cases For Findyourvenue Booking System [Internet]. My Assignment Help. 2020 [cited 23 February 2024]. Available from: https://myassignmenthelp.com/free-samples/ict115-introduction-to-systems-design-11.

Get instant help from 5000+ experts for
question

Writing: Get your essay and assignment written from scratch by PhD expert

Rewriting: Paraphrase or rewrite your friend's essay with similar meaning at reduced cost

Editing: Proofread your work by experts and improve grade at Lowest cost

loader
250 words
Phone no. Missing!

Enter phone no. to receive critical updates and urgent messages !

Attach file

Error goes here

Files Missing!

Please upload all relevant files for quick & complete assistance.

Other Similar Samples

support
Whatsapp
callback
sales
sales chat
Whatsapp
callback
sales chat
close